Transaction 23e36d2a93bec321712614d98f08e5efa53aa3a50529bf3bc33e1128b355b285

1 Input
2 Outputs
  • 23e36d2a93bec321712614d98f08e5efa53aa3a50529bf3bc33e1128b355b285:0
  • value  5000000
    address  14AGYvuDVjrWhmDYkC3wTYet5i4XuBvLg2
  • 23e36d2a93bec321712614d98f08e5efa53aa3a50529bf3bc33e1128b355b285:1
  • value  7917934
    address  1MsSJK5eCzns8MbaK4YyaBYwtbaSJU8vLg